steve7stud 0 Posted June 13, 2009 Share Posted June 13, 2009 Guys, why is Kongo a dog vs Velasquez? Is Velasquez really that good?Velaqquez is a beast. A lot of people consider him to be the most talented fighter to come out of AKA.He has really good stand up, but he will be at a reach disadvantage in this fight.He is world class wrestler. So if he is smart he takes this fight to the ground..........where Kongo has shown to have great weakness.The problem with this fight is that Velasquez likes to go for the finish. If he gets the fight to the ground it might be harder to do from a wrestling stand point. He could become stubborn and want to keep the fight standing. If he does that, Kongo has a bit of an edge. If he fights a smart fight, he has the tools to win. Link to post Share on other sites
